Kojima mysteriously bows out of his GDC 2026 Keynote speech

The Death Stranding 2 director was set to present at the Game Developer’s Conference, or as it’s now being called, the “GDC Festival of Gaming,” to talk about his fateful decision a decade ago to go independent after a messy breakup with Konami. Now his company, Kojima Productions, is saying he won’t be able to attend, but not giving the reason why.

“We regret to inform you that Hideo Kojima will no longer be able to attend this year’s GDC Festival of Gaming,” it announced on February 6. “We understand that this will be disappointing for fans and attendees who were looking forward to hearing him speak, and we want to offer our deepest apologies. While Hideo Kojima is unable to attend in person, KOJIMA PRODUCTIONS is still excited to be part of this year’s festival, with members of the team presenting during the week. We wish everyone at the GDC Festival of Gaming a fantastic event. We hope to reconnect with you all soon.”

Is the sudden last minute pull-out related to a dispute with the venue, concerns about the political climate in the U.S. and traveling here as a foreigner, or a surprise, last-minute scheduling conflict? Kojima recently tweeted that he’s back in the editing bay, suggesting an announcement for something new in the near future. An update on OD? Something about Physint? Ubisoft reportedly canceled an unannounced multiplayer Assassin’s Creed game

That’s according to French site Origami which claims the project was codenamed League. It was reportedly a cooperative game set in the world of Assassin’s Creed Shadows that was in development at Annecy under a team of nearly 85 people. The studio was also reportedly working on an Assassin’s Creed MMO at one point called Echoes that also didn’t come together.

MachineGames boss says game prices can’t keep going up

While companies push $80 games and fans worry about Grand Theft Auto 6 costing $100, Wolfenstein studio director Jerk Gustafsson thinks companies need to focus more on smarter game development. “What can you do in terms of being more efficient?” he told GamesIndustry.biz. “What can we do to continue to promote our products? What can we do with our back catalogue to make sure that our older games can bring new life into those new platforms?” He also all but confirmed a third game is happening, as Kotaku previously reported.

Players are in a propaganda war with Helldivers 2‘s robots

The game has been parodying the brutality of Super Earth’s soldiers from the point of view of enemies like the Automatons to great effect. It all seems like it’s leading up to something potentially big, including the return of Cyborgs and another invasion of Super Earth. Arrowhead Game Studios CEO Shams Jorjani is having fun and spamming the Discord channel with messages in binary that read “you’re going to shit your pants.”
